Family lost everything in Keltnertown Road fire last night

Adair County Judge Ann Melton's office Suite 1, Adair Annex, 424 Public Square, Columbia, KY, is point for gifts to help Mary McGuffin's family through a difficult time.

By Lisa Greer
Administrative in Adair County Judge Executive's Office

The family of Mary McGuffin, 1390 Keltnertown Rd, Columbia KY 42728, lost everything they had yesterday in a house fire. Mary has seven children and works at Westlake Regional Hospital (ER). Below are the sizes that are needed:
